A Secret Weapon For what is md5 technology
A Secret Weapon For what is md5 technology
Blog Article
Preimage assaults. MD5 is vulnerable to preimage attacks, the place an attacker can discover an enter that hashes to a specific worth. This capability to reverse-engineer a hash weakens MD5’s performance in preserving sensitive info.
One method to greatly enhance the safety of MD5 is by making use of a technique known as 'salting'. This really is like incorporating an extra solution component to your favorite recipe.
In 2004 it was shown that MD5 is not collision-resistant.[27] As such, MD5 is not really well suited for programs like SSL certificates or digital signatures that count on this property for digital stability. Scientists Moreover learned far more critical flaws in MD5, and described a feasible collision assault—a way to create a set of inputs for which MD5 makes similar checksums.
In line with eWeek, a recognised weakness inside the MD5 hash operate gave the group of risk actors powering the Flame malware the ability to forge a valid certificate for that Microsoft's Home windows Update assistance.
MD5 as well as other cryptographic hash algorithms are one-way capabilities, which means they aren’t utilized to encrypt documents—it’s not possible to reverse the hashing system to Recuperate the first knowledge.
Technology is vital to modern-day dwelling and is closely connected to nearly every Component of our day by day life. From waking up to a digital alarm to managing tasks with AI-powered assistants, technology has substantially transformed how we talk, operate, understand, and entertain ourselves.
Every single block is processed in the four-round loop that employs a collection of constants attained within the sine purpose to conduct diverse bitwise operations and nonlinear functions.
It check here stays appropriate for other non-cryptographic uses, such as for pinpointing the partition for a particular key inside a partitioned database, and may be favored as a result of reduced computational needs than More moderen Safe Hash Algorithms.[4]
Also, the MD5 algorithm creates a hard and fast dimensions hash— Regardless how big or compact your enter data is, the output hash will almost always be a similar size. This uniformity is a superb feature, particularly when comparing hashes or storing them.
the procedure can be a 1-way functionality. That means, When you have the hash, you shouldn't be capable of reverse it to uncover the initial data. Using this method, you are able to Test info integrity without the need of exposing the information alone.
The key employs of MD5 involve examining data integrity in file transfers, password storage, and verifying the authenticity of digital documents.
An MD5 collision assault occurs when a hacker sends a destructive file With all the same hash to be a clean up file.
MD5 works by breaking up the enter information into blocks, after which iterating above Just about every block to apply a series of mathematical functions to produce an output that is unique for that block. These outputs are then merged and further processed to supply the ultimate digest.
As preceding exploration has shown, "it ought to be regarded cryptographically damaged and unsuitable for even further use."